MINING NEWS.

SUBSIDY JUSTIFIED

The subsidised gold mining mid prospecting scheme, which was introduced sit t'oromandel in November, 1081, is said to have justified itself. The report for the six months ended December 31 last shows that the principal areas in which tin: men are working are CnromandPl (.".."> men). Kuaotunu CJ), Ttiirua. Hikuai (!)). The quantity of gold won by subsidised men during this Inter period was If):!o7., valued at 0)42. and the production of gold during this period was approximately 23 per cent greater than that of. liic previous six months.
